QuickBooks error H303 is part of the H-series errors and typically occurs when transitioning to multi-user mode. Error code H303 displays an error message stating, This company file is on another computer, and QuickBooks needs assistance connecting. QuickBooks requires a network connection for access when attempting to open a company file located elsewhere.

This error prevents you from hosting your company file on a multi-user network, indicating an obstruction in establishing a connection to your server for multi-user access. What causes the multi-user mode Error in QB?

Several factors may cause error code H303 when transitioning to multi-user mode. Read these points to familiarize yourself with them.

  • Incorrect configuration of Windows firewall settings.
  • QuickBooks Database services might not running on your server computer.

Solution 1: Adjust Your Firewall Connection Settings

Improper configuration of Windows firewall settings may block QuickBooks files, hindering multi-user connections. Follow the steps below to adjust these settings.

  • Open the Windows Start menu by pressing the Windows icon key on your keyboard.
  • Type Windows Firewall in the search box and open it.
  • Navigate to Advanced Settings and right-click on Inbound Rules.
  • Click on New Rule to create a new rule.
  • Choose Port and click Next.
  • Choose TCP and provide the precise local ports to use:
  • QuickBooks Desktop 2020 and later: 8019, XXXXX.
  • QuickBooks Desktop 2019: 8019, XXXXX.
  • QuickBooks Desktop 2018: 8019, 56728, 55378-55382.
  • QuickBooks Desktop 2017: 8019, 56727, 55373-55377.
  • Click Next and choose Allow the Connection.
  • Click Next to ensure all profiles are checked. Then click 'Next' again.
  • Name the rule as QBPorts(year) and click Finish.
  • After creating the rule, try hosting your company file in a multi-user network again.

Solution 2: Verify That QuickBooks Services Are Running on Your Server Computer

The QuickBooks Database Server Manager services facilitate hosting the company file on a multi-user network. If these services are not running, it can disrupt hosting and lead to this error.

  • Open the Windows Start menu on the computer that serves you. 
  • Enter Run in the search bar and press Enter.
  • In the Run dialog box, type services. msc and press Enter.
  • Find and click on QuickBooksDBXX in the list of services and double-click to open its properties.
  • Set the Startup Type to Automatic.
  • Check the service's current status. It should be either Running or Started. If it's not, click on Start.
